Position Summary | The University of New Mexico High School Equivalency Program (UNM HEP) is designed to assist migrant and seasonal agricultural workers and their immediate family members in obtaining their High School Equivalency (HSE) diploma. UNM HEP is federally funded by the US Department of Education under the Office of Migrant Education. UNM HEP offers an intensive, holistic HSE course for its qualifying participants each year. UNM HEP is seeking a self-motivated, enthusiastic, positive individual who will provide instruction to HEP participants to attain their high school diploma. The HSE instructor provides basic reading, writing, social studies, math, and science instruction. Classes and instruction will be conducted online, while office hours will be held in person. There is also a possibility that some teaching may take place in person. The instructor will not be limited to teaching; they will be an active participant in the implementation of the HEP grant. This includes providing guidance to the HEP tutors, assisting in retention efforts, and providing workshops outside of the classroom. UNM HEP also hosts social and cultural activities for the students, and the instructors participate in the creation, development and facilitation of said activities. The instructor will design, evaluate, and implement curriculum for the UNM HEP intensive English & Spanish HSE courses that includes adult learning theory and methodologies.
